"Sun-Kissed" Makeup: Your Complete Buying Guide
Extend summer's glow with smart product choices. Warm days fade, but nothing stops you from capturing that vacation radiance through makeup — and achieving professional results doesn't require expensive salon visits ($80-$200 per session).
The "sun-kissed" look delivers that just-back-from-the-beach appearance: bronzed, luminous, natural. This universally flattering style works for nearly everyone, and recreating it proves surprisingly straightforward when you select the right products.
Foundation Essentials Worth Considering
Start with quality hydration: a rich serum or cream ($25-$65) creates smooth, radiant skin. When choosing foundation, opt for lightweight formulas with natural finishes ($30-$55) — they enhance facial contours better than many highlighters.
Before you buy separate illuminating products, consider that proper foundation often delivers sufficient glow. However, if you're after extra "sunlit" luminosity, a champagne-toned highlighter ($18-$45) applied to cheekbones and inner eye corners creates that premium effect. Creating the Tan Effect
The key product remains creamy bronzer ($15-$50). Distribute it across cheekbones, jawline, and temples to build soft shadows mimicking sun-touched skin. When comparing bronzer options, cream formulas blend more naturally than powders, making them the top choice for this technique.

Eye Makeup That Delivers
Achieving the sun-kissed gaze requires minimal investment: light copper eyeshadow or smudged brown pencil ($10-$30). This approach adds warmth and definition while keeping the look effortless. These shades prove reliable for creating that coveted heated appearance without complex techniques.
If you're shopping for eye products, consider multi-use options — cream bronzers often work beautifully on lids, helping you save while maintaining a cohesive aesthetic.
"Sun-Kissed" Blush Application
Cream blushes in peach or terracotta shades ($12-$42) represent an essential step. Apply them not only to cheeks but lightly under eyes and across the bridge of your nose. This technique specifically creates that "toasted skin" effect professionals charge premium rates to achieve.
When selecting blush, compare formulations — cream versions offer superior blending and natural finish compared to powder alternatives. The Finishing Touch
Complete the look with gloss or lipstick in apricot tones ($8-$35). Subtle shine on lips provides the harmonious final detail supporting the overall "sunlit" story. This finishing product typically lasts 3-6 months, making it an economical addition to your routine.
